Sales Manager - Composites
Salary: 50,000 - 60,000 Bonus: up to 30% bonus based off annual salary. Package: Company car, hybrid working, 25 days holiday, pension, progression
Location: Nationwide (Field based role)Overview My client is seeking an experienced and commercially driven Sales Manager to join their growing composites division.
This is a field-based, standalone sales role focused on driving new business growth while managing an established portfolio of key accounts across the UK and Ireland.
The successful candidate will combine strong technical knowledge of the composites industry with a proactive sales approach, helping to expand market share and support the company's ambitious growth plans.
Key Responsibilities Develop and win new business opportunities, with approximately 70% of the role focused on new customer acquisition and 30% on managing key accounts.
Build and maintain strong relationships with existing and prospective customers across the composites sector.
Identify and develop opportunities within formulators and manufacturers using specialist raw materials.
Manage a healthy sales pipeline and deliver against agreed sales and activity KPIs.
Meet customer engagement targets while maintaining regular contact with existing accounts.
Work independently to identify commercial opportunities and manage your own territory effectively.
Travel throughout the UK and Ireland as required, including occasional visits to the head office in Kent.
Candidate Requirements Essential Strong technical knowledge of the composites sector.
Alternatively, a degree in Chemistry with some relevant industry experience.
Or significant proven experience in composites sales.
Understanding/awareness of polymer technologies including:* Epoxy Polyester Vinyl Ester Ability to distinguish between commodity polymers and specialist polymers/distribution models.
Self-motivated with the ability to work autonomously in a field-based role.
Strong commercial awareness and relationship-building skills.
Full UK driving licence.
Desirable Previous experience selling specialist raw materials into formulators.
Existing relationships with key companies within the composites industry.
Experience working for or selling to leading composites manufacturers.
